**Key Responsibilities**
- **Guest Experience & Service Excellence:** Lead front-of-house operations to create a consistently welcoming and engaging atmosphere. Collaborate with the Director of Hospitality to train staff in delivering outstanding guest experiences, focusing on education, hospitality, and storytelling.
- **Operations & Inventory Management:** Oversee wine bar service, manage reservations, maintain inventory, and ensure smooth POS and cash handling procedures.
- **Sales & Wine Club Engagement:** Actively drive wine sales, encourage wine club sign-ups, and foster repeat business through meaningful guest interactions and relationship-building.
- **Private Events & Hospitality Programming:** Assist with inquiries, coordinate logistics, and execute private tastings, wine dinners, and special events in collaboration with our team.
- **Staff Leadership & Training:** Hire, train, and mentor a small team of wine and service professionals, maintaining a culture of excellence, accountability, and enthusiasm.
- **Marketing & Community Engagement:** Support social media initiatives, email marketing, and local outreach to enhance awareness and engagement with the wine bar.
- **Compliance & Best Practices:** Ensure adherence to ABC regulations, food safety standards, labor laws, and all daily operational protocols.

**Preferred Experience & Skills**
- A minimum of 2+ years of lead or management experience in hospitality (wine bar, tasting room, restaurant, or similar).
- Strong wine knowledge (certifications like WSET or CMS are a plus but not required).
- Experience managing POS, reservations, and CRM systems (such as Tock, Square, Commerce7, etc.).
- Proven ability to drive sales, wine club memberships, and customer engagement.
- Flexibility to work evenings, weekends, and events as needed.
